23-Year-Old Former Google Engineer Leaves Job to Focus on Podcast and AI Startup

Analysed 23 Jun 2026·2 sources analysed·California, United States·tech
23-Year-Old Former Google Engineer Leaves Job to Focus on Podcast and AI StartupPreviousNext

Aashna Doshi, a 23-year-old former Google software engineer, chose to leave her stable role to pursue broader interests in storytelling and entrepreneurship. After turning down an initial Google offer in California to work in New York, she accepted a later role there. While at Google, she co-founded the '0 to 1' podcast, which gained significant traction and helped her network with industry leaders. She has since left Google to focus on her AI startup and podcast full-time, citing a desire to build and own her projects beyond engineering tasks.
